Intent
Execute retrieve to fetch specific, known information from specified sources. Unlike search (which explores under uncertainty), retrieve fetches identified items with full provenance tracking.
Success criteria:
- Requested data is fetched completely
- Source and timestamp are recorded
- Data integrity is verified where possible
- Citations enable re-retrieval
- Missing data is explicitly flagged

Procedure
-
Identify target: Determine exactly what to fetch
- File path: Exact file location
- URL: Web resource address
- API endpoint: Service + parameters
- Record: Database/system identifier
-
Verify source accessibility: Confirm retrieval is possible
- Check permissions
- Verify network access if remote
- Confirm source exists
-
Execute retrieval: Fetch the data
- For files: Read with line numbers preserved
- For URLs: Fetch with timeout and retry
- For APIs: Call with appropriate auth
- Record exact timestamp of retrieval
-
Validate retrieved data: Check completeness and integrity
- Verify format matches expected
- Check for truncation or corruption
- Validate against schema if available
- Compute hash for integrity tracking
-
Extract relevant portions: If constraints specified
- Apply filters to reduce data
- Project specific fields
- Slice by line numbers or sections
-
Construct citation: Build verifiable reference
- Full path/URL
- Timestamp of retrieval
- Version/revision if available
- Hash for integrity verification
-
Document provenance: Record retrieval metadata
- Source authority
- Freshness (how current)
- Reliability (historical accuracy)
-
Handle failures: If retrieval fails
- Record failure reason
- Suggest alternatives if available
- Note partial success if applicable

Verification
Verification tools: Hash verification, re-retrieval test
Safety Constraints
mutation: false
requires_checkpoint: false
requires_approval: false
risk: low
Capability-specific rules:
- Do not retrieve from paths marked as sensitive
- Respect rate limits on remote sources
- Flag stale data (>24h old for volatile sources)
- Never fabricate retrieved content
